Find Bugs

GPTKB entity

Statements (92)
Predicate Object
gptkbp:instance_of gptkb:software
gptkbp:bfsLayer 4
gptkbp:bfsParent gptkb:Java_2_Platform,_Standard_Edition_(J2_SE)_1.3
gptkbp:analyzes gptkb:Java_bytecode
Java classes
gptkbp:category gptkb:software
gptkbp:dependency gptkb:software
gptkbp:developed_by gptkb:Spot_Bugs
gptkbp:first_released gptkb:2003
gptkbp:has user community
gptkbp:has_feature Graphical user interface
Batch processing
Customizable settings
Plugin architecture
Historical analysis
Command line interface
Report generation
Static code analysis
IDE integration
Code quality metrics
Integration with CI/ CD tools
Custom bug filters
Multi-threaded analysis
https://www.w3.org/2000/01/rdf-schema#label Find Bugs
gptkbp:input_output gptkb:XML
gptkb:software
gptkb:poet
gptkbp:integrates_with gptkb:Maven
gptkb:award
gptkb:Gradle
Intelli JIDEA
gptkbp:is gptkb:software
gptkb:Library
gptkb:project
deprecated
used in research
used in enterprise applications
used in automated testing
used in continuous integration
used in software development
used in open-source projects
used in educational purposes
no longer actively maintained
used for bug detection
used for code quality assurance
used in code review
used in commercial software
gptkbp:is_available_on gptkb:Source_Forge
gptkb:archive
gptkbp:is_part_of Software development tools
gptkbp:is_used_by Software developers
Quality assurance teams
Code reviewers
gptkbp:language gptkb:Java
gptkbp:latest_version 3.0.1
gptkbp:license gptkb:GNU_Lesser_General_Public_License
gptkbp:platform Cross-platform
gptkbp:provides Recommendations
Warnings
command line interface
HTML report
XML output
Bug patterns
Eclipse plugin
bug patterns
gptkbp:purpose Detect bugs in Java programs
gptkbp:recognizes Security vulnerabilities
security vulnerabilities
Performance issues
Deadlocks
performance issues
concurrency issues
Unused variables
code smells
Null pointer dereferences
Bad practice patterns
Infinite recursive calls
bad practices
defects in Java programs
gptkbp:replaced_by gptkb:Spot_Bugs
gptkbp:requires Java 1.5 or higher
gptkbp:successor gptkb:Spot_Bugs
gptkbp:supports gptkb:Net_Beans_IDE
gptkb:award
gptkb:Java_Enhancement_Proposal
Intelli JIDEA
gptkbp:type gptkb:project
gptkbp:uses Bytecode analysis
bytecode analysis
gptkbp:website http://findbugs.sourceforge.net
gptkbp:written_by gptkb:William_Pugh
gptkbp:written_in gptkb:Java